Top Hotel Franchises
First on our list of top hotel franchises is Choice Hotels. Choice provides its franchisees with property management systems, reservation schemes and training programs that will have customers coming to your business in droves. Choice is also committed to providing franchisees with emerging markets team members who support the first time owners and make their new endeavor less stressful.
Many people would ask why you should start a hotel franchise in the first place. Well, the hotel industry is growing. In fact, in 2006, hotel revenues totaled over $133 billion with roughly 52% of gross hotel operating profit margins. That was excluding beverage and food options, having a lager ROI potential than the vast majority of businesses. And since the 1990s, profits and revenue have almost doubled. So as you can see, franchise hotel ownership has high potential as a wealth-building asset as well.
Starting a new business is always daunting and time consuming, however choosing a company that has created many successful businesses and that has a very strong track record can help quite a bit. But why Choice Hotels do you ask? They simply deliver business to your franchise. Their reservations system ended up netting their franchises a total of $2 billion dollars just in 2007. Coupled with their national marketing schemes and sales force, customers will begin to show up on your front doorstep in no time. Some very compelling reasons to become a franchisee of Choice Hotels:
Dedicated team members who will make your hotel industry transition an amazingly seamless process.
They are one of the worlds largest and leading hotel franchisors.
You are given an outstanding set of services, resources, property management systems and training programs designed for efficient operations and maximized profitability.
Choice Hotels spends roughly $175 million each year in order to market and advertise to potential customers whilst raising brand awareness at the same time.
And not to mention the fact that Choice Hotels portfolio consist of many top hotel franchises like Comfort Suites, Comfort Inn, Clarion, Sleep Inn, Quality, Main Stay Suites, Cambria Suites, Rodeway Inn, Suburban Extended Stay Hotels and the Econo Lodge.
Wingate by Wyndham
Next up on the list of top hotel franchises is Wingate by Wyndham. These hotels are all newly constructed and feature standard amenities, all-inclusive pricing and were designed using input from travel agents, seasoned travelers and hotel developers in order to be an upper mid-market business hotel with limited service. And between Canada and the U.S., they have 160 hotels in operation as of today. The Wyndham Hotel Group, the largest franchisor in the World, owns Wingate by Wyndham. They are the largest franchisor because they own 10 different lodging brands on six continents with a grand total of 6,500 hotels and 535,000 total rooms.
The Wyndham Hotel Group will spare no expense when it comes to its support and services programs. Whether in Canada or the U.S., they will help their franchisees whilst undergoing the development of their hotel and will provide them with guidance and training so they better understand how to run an efficient and profitable venture. Their franchise support consist of:
* National marketing campaigns.
* Trip rewards.
* Procurement and design services.
* Global sales assistance.
* Training.
* Support with field operations.
Wingate by Wyndham franchisees also benefit from extensive training, central reservations system access, reliable support staff, a tool that tracks your guest’s satisfaction and the ability to participate in the Trip Rewards program which is a hotel rewards scheme.

Pet-Friendly Places to Stay in Flagstaff, AZ
If you are traveling to Sedona and the Grand Canyon area with your pets, here are some pet-friendly hotels in the Flagstaff area who will welcome your furry friends while you are enjoying this scenic and popular travel destination.
The following hotels welcome canine and feline companions – some charge an additional fee. Call to confirm their policies and fees.
Ramada Limited – Flagstaff – Pets allowed for a $10.00 add’l fee for each pet. Other amenities include swimming pool, free high speed internet, and free continental breakfast – (928) 779-3614.
Quality Inn – Inside entrances. Pets welcome – free wireless high-speed internet, pool and free HBO. 928-774-8771.
Residence Inn by Marriott, Flagstaff – Pets allowed with extra cleaning fee. Suite-type accommodations with fully equipped kitchen. Buffet breakfast served daily. (928) 526-5555
La Quinta – Conveniently located across from Northern Arizona University. Fitness center, outdoor seasonal pool, free high speed internet access, free continental breakfast-pets welcome (928 ) 556-8666.
Comfort Inn, Flagstaff – Pets are welcome for a modest fee. Other features include business center, free high speed internet, free continental breakfast, outdoor pool, whirlpool and hot tub (800) 490-6562.
AmeriSuites, Flagstaff – fitness center, indoor pool, whirlpool, free hot breakfast and free high speed internet. Pet friendly – $10.00 per pet per night.
Sleep Inn, Flagstaff – Pet friendly, free continental breakfast, free wireless internet, heated pool and spa. ( 928) 556-3000
Super 8, Flagstaff – Pets allowed – $10.00 per pet per night. High speed internet, and free continental breakfast. (928) 526-0818.
Contact the hotels for further information and to confirm amenities. Hotel policies are subject to change without notice.
